Jonas Callmer is a scholar working on Aerospace Engineering,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Artificial Intelligence. According to data from OpenAlex, Jonas Callmer has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 270 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Aerospace Engineering, 8 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 4 papers in Artificial Intelligence. Recurrent topics in Jonas Callmer’s work include Indoor and Outdoor Localization Technologies (6 papers), Robotics and Sensor-Based Localization (5 papers) and Target Tracking and Data Fusion in Sensor Networks (4 papers). Jonas Callmer is often cited by papers focused on Indoor and Outdoor Localization Technologies (6 papers), Robotics and Sensor-Based Localization (5 papers) and Target Tracking and Data Fusion in Sensor Networks (4 papers). Jonas Callmer collaborates with scholars based in Sweden and Australia. Jonas Callmer's co-authors include Fredrik Gustafsson, David Törnqvist, Fábio Ramos, Karl Granström and Niklas Wahlström and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Wireless Communications and EURASIP Journal on Advances in Signal Processing.
